Market Overview
The Japan polypropylene (PP) packaging films market is a dynamic sector within the broader packaging industry, characterized by its versatile applications and significant growth potential. Polypropylene packaging films are widely used due to their excellent clarity, high tensile strength, moisture resistance, and cost-effectiveness. These properties make them ideal for packaging a variety of products, including food and beverages, pharmaceuticals, personal care items, and industrial goods. In Japan, the demand for PP packaging films is driven by the country’s advanced manufacturing sector, high standards of living, and stringent regulatory environment that emphasizes sustainability and safety. The market is influenced by the growing trend towards flexible packaging, which offers convenience and reduces waste. Additionally, innovations in film production technologies, such as multi-layer films and biodegradable PP films, are expanding the market’s capabilities and applications. The ongoing efforts to develop eco-friendly packaging solutions and the increasing consumer awareness regarding sustainable packaging further drive the market. Despite challenges such as environmental concerns and competition from alternative packaging materials, the Japan PP packaging films market is poised for significant growth.

Market Driver
The primary driver of the Japan PP packaging films market is the growing demand for flexible packaging solutions. Flexible packaging offers numerous advantages, including convenience, lightweight, reduced storage space, and improved shelf life of products. These benefits are particularly significant in the food and beverage industry, which is a major consumer of PP packaging films. The increasing consumer preference for on-the-go food products, ready-to-eat meals, and single-serve packaging options fuels the demand for flexible packaging. Additionally, the rising awareness about food safety and hygiene, especially in the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ic, has led to an increased adoption of PP packaging films, which provide excellent barrier properties against moisture, oxygen, and contaminants. The pharmaceutical industry also drives the demand for PP packaging films due to their use in blister packs, sachets, and strip packs, ensuring the safety and integrity of pharmaceutical products. Furthermore, the advancements in film production technologies, such as the development of multi-layer films and high-performance PP films, enhance the functionality and application range of PP packaging films, contributing to market growth.
Market Restraint
Despite the favorable market conditions, the Japan PP packaging films market faces several restraints. One significant challenge is the environmental impact of polypropylene, a petroleum-based polymer. The increasing concerns about plastic pollution and the stringent regulations regarding plastic waste management pose challenges to the growth of PP packaging films. The Japanese government’s initiatives to reduce plastic waste and promote recycling and the use of biodegradable materials exert pressure on the PP packaging industry to adopt more sustainable practices. Another restraint is the competition from alternative packaging materials, such as polyethylene terephthalate (PET), polyethylene (PE), and biodegradable plastics, which offer similar benefits but with potentially lower environmental impact. The fluctuating raw material prices and supply chain disruptions also affect the profitability and production costs of PP packaging films. Additionally, the high cost of advanced film production technologies and the need for continuous innovation to meet regulatory standards and consumer preferences can be challenging for market players.

Market Segment Analysis
Food and Beverage Packaging
The food and beverage industry is the largest consumer of PP packaging films in Japan. PP films are widely used for packaging a variety of food products, including snacks, confectionery, fresh produce, and frozen foods, due to their excellent barrier properties, clarity, and durability. The increasing consumer preference for convenience foods, ready-to-eat meals, and single-serve packaging options drives the demand for PP packaging films. Additionally, the growing awareness about food safety and hygiene has led to the increased adoption of PP films, which protect food products from moisture, oxygen, and contaminants, thereby extending their shelf life. Innovations in film production technologies, such as the development of multi-layer films and high-performance PP films, enhance the functionality and application range of PP packaging films in the food and beverage industry. The trend towards sustainable packaging solutions also drives the demand for recyclable and biodegradable PP films, catering to the growing consumer preference for eco-friendly packaging options.
The pharmaceutical industry is another significant consumer of PP packaging films in Japan. PP films are used in various pharmaceutical packaging applications, including blister packs, sachets, and strip packs, due to their excellent barrier properties, chemical resistance, and durability. The increasing demand for pharmaceutical products, driven by the aging population and the rising prevalence of chronic diseases, fuels the demand for PP packaging films. The stringent regulatory requirements for pharmaceutical packaging, which ensure the safety and integrity of pharmaceutical products, also drive the adoption of high-quality PP films. The advancements in film production technologies, such as the development of high-performance PP films with enhanced barrier properties and the use of advanced printing techniques, further drive the growth of the pharmaceutical packaging segment. Additionally, the trend towards sustainable packaging solutions in the pharmaceutical industry creates opportunities for the development and adoption of recyclable and biodegradable PP films.
